Google is so deeply part of the digital life that it is difficult not to look in Google. But that is not the case for The Little Mermaid Star Sierra Bogges.

Remembering why I no longer search on Google, said the actress, who played Ariel at the Broadway show in 2007 Us weekly, “I will always remember the first time I was about to make my debut on Broadway and nobody knew who I was.”

“Google was something new. It was 2006. I remember seeing someone to say: ‘Who is this Sierra Boggess?’ I learned to never look again on Google from that. “

“Calling someone, nobody is the worst thing you can do because it is devaluing someone’s presence in the world,” he continued. “My conclusion is to make sure that I am never the one who treats people as they are not nobodies.”

“It is good for us to be striking and celebrated, but we are creating works of art that include everyone involved. So you are never the problem. It’s a good motto!”

Despite the initial questions about his talent, Sierra showed that his skeptics were wrong. She has a remarkable race on stage, appearing in several Broadway productions such as The opera ghost, rock school, and Harmony.
